NAME
live-tools - System Support ScriptsDESCRIPTION
live-tools contains additional support scripts for Debian Live systems.TOOLS
live-tools currently contains the following tools.
- live-update-initramfs(8)
- writes out updated kernel and initrd images to the live media. This wrapper replaces the update-initramfs command provided by the initramfs-tools package.
- live-toram
- copies running system to RAM in order to eject the live media.
- live-system
- determines if running system is a debian-live based system.
- live-uptime(1)
- tells how long the system has been running (works with LXC). This wrapper replaces the uptime command provided by the procps package.
- live-persistence(1)
-
switches a non-persistent system to using persistence at runtime.
